Getting Started with 3 Ways To Bring Your Furry Friend To Life: A Step-By-Step Guide To Drawing Dogs

So, if you're ready to bring your furry friend to life on paper, here are some essential tips to get you started:

  • Observe your dog's behavior and body language to capture their unique personality.
  • Practice basic drawing techniques, such as proportion, perspective, and shading.
  • Experiment with different mediums, like pencils, markers, and paints, to find what works best for you.
  • Join online communities and share your work with others to stay motivated and inspired.
  • Don't be afraid to make mistakes – they're an essential part of the creative process!

Common Curiosities About 3 Ways To Bring Your Furry Friend To Life: A Step-By-Step Guide To Drawing Dogs

As with any art form, there are numerous questions and concerns surrounding the practice of drawing dogs. Here are some answers to common curiosities:

Q: Do I need formal training or experience to draw dogs?

A: No, drawing dogs is accessible to everyone, regardless of artistic background or experience. With practice and patience, you can develop your skills and create beautiful dog art.

Q: How long does it take to see improvement in my drawing skills?

A: This depends on individual factors, such as the frequency and quality of practice. With consistent effort, you can see noticeable improvements in your drawing skills within a few weeks or months.
